666509856021294470040048670131877614950247447170592810
Even
666509856021294470040048670131877614950247447170592810 is even
Previous even number is 666509856021294470040048670131877614950247447170592808
Next even number is 666509856021294470040048670131877614950247447170592812
Cubed
296087264611101130542758986296880708687176632490558131893084124897982654858192541562407744231997794480810328922326574345709216306308604140487940447982592285041000
Squared
444235388173526684320431761179465030711155970165869980148623025134642139291993272350939253387214046823696100
Binary
11011110101011011001000110010110110011001100101101110100100111101111101011000011011110001110111000000001001111101101001011001011110110110111010000001111000010010110011000000101010
Hexadecimal
Octal
336533106266314556447575303361670011755131366672017022630052